Abstract
Systems and methods are described that facilitate improving paging signal strength at or near sector perimeters in a wireless network region by transmitted identical paging waveforms simultaneously from all sectors in the region and permitting over-the-air signal aggregation to combine signal energy near sector perimeters. Waveforms can be modulated using an orthogonal frequency division multiplexing technique and can be simultaneously transmitted according to predefined transmission resources over a multi-sector broadcast paging channel reserved for such identical waveforms. Cyclic prefix can be added to the identical waveforms to mitigate problems associated with delay spread and/or time-of-arrival differences at or near sector perimeters.

12. A system that facilitates simultaneously transmitting pages to all subscriber stations in a paging region of a wireless network, comprising:
-
a plurality of transmitters, each of which is located in one of a plurality of sectors of the paging region; and
a waveform generation component associated with each transmitter, which receives information related to a list of all incoming pages for the paging region and generates a waveform comprising all pages for the region;
wherein the waveform generation components in each sector generate substantially identical waveforms. - View Dependent Claims (13, 14, 15, 16, 17, 18, 19)
